Karen Morris will show you how to create a fashion-forward fabric headpiece to accessorize your next Fancy Dress function. Use textiles and draping techniques to make a crown shaped headpiece with no hat block involved. Open to beginners with basic sewing experience.

What to Bring

  • One-yard woven fabric – Light-weight or medium-weight cotton, medium-weight silk like silk faille, light-weight wool or wool blend, tweeds, light-weight denim, light-weight canvas is recommended.
  • Coordinating Thread
  • Sharp Fabric Scissors and snips
  • Handsewing needles (long with small eye is best)  and Bead-headed pins
  • Point Turner
  • Pencil and notepad

*Karen Morris is an internationally acclaimed hat designer and milliner.  She started her line, Karen Morris Millinery, in 2011.  Karen studied millinery under famous milliners Edwina Ibbotson (London), Judy Bentinck (London), Jan Wutkowski (North Carolina) and Lina Stein (Ireland).

Karen was born in the British colony of Hong Kong, and moved to America in 2009. Her hats have been worn by celebrities including Rebel Wilson and Nicki Minaj, and at events around the world, including the Kentucky Derby, Royal Ascot, and to meet the Queen of England.

Karen’s work has been featured at museums and fashion events, including Fashion Week MN, Voltage, the American Craft Council, the Smithsonian and Pure London. Her work has appeared in Vogue, ELLE, Harper’s Bazaar, Hatalk, Pioneer Press and StarTribune, and seen on PBS’ MN Original, Fox 9 and WCCO TV.

Karen’s hats are available at distinguished boutiques, in her NE Minneapolis studio and shop, as well as online (kmhats.com).

Her work inspirations are from traveling, architectures and art sculptures. Philosophy of brand “Karen Morris Millinery” is Quality, Simplicity and Elegance.  Karen aims to apply both traditional and modern skills to develop a variety of hat shapes and textures, transformed into multi-functional collections that can be worn in an everyday environment, and yet still has a modern twist.

Most of the hats are formed with different shape of wooden hat blocks and handmade of exotic materials sourced from around the world. I love collaborating with local artists or designers to bring new design elements to my collections. 

Teaching is also part of Karen’s career.  She has been teaching hat-making locally and internationally.  She hopes her effort can bring this long-lost craft – Millinery back to live.
